Question 1: Are these holiday-themed coloring resources truly without cost?
The term “free” indicates that the resources are offered without initial monetary charge. However, users may incur costs associated with printing, such as paper and ink. Licensing restrictions may also apply regarding commercial use of the images.
Question 2: What file formats are commonly used for holiday-themed art resources?
Common formats include PDF (Portable Document Format) for print-ready documents and JPEG or PNG for individual images. Vector formats such as SVG may also be available, allowing for scalable resizing without loss of quality.
Question 3: What is the typical resolution of these resources?
Resolution varies. Resources intended for high-quality printing typically have a resolution of 300 DPI (dots per inch). Lower resolution images may be suitable for digital coloring or smaller prints. Verify resolution prior to printing to ensure satisfactory results.
Question 4: Are these resources subject to copyright restrictions?
Copyright restrictions vary based on the source. Many resources are offered under Creative Commons licenses, which grant certain usage rights while reserving others. Commercial use is often restricted without explicit permission from the copyright holder. Review licensing terms prior to use.
Question 5: How can the authenticity and safety of these digital resources be verified?
Download resources from reputable websites to minimize the risk of malware or viruses. Employ virus scanning software to scan downloaded files. Exercise caution when providing personal information on websites offering these resources.

Tips for Effective Utilization
The following guidelines aim to maximize the benefits derived from readily available holiday-themed line art intended for printing and coloring activities.
Tip 1: Verify Image Resolution Prior to Printing. Inadequate resolution can result in pixelated or blurred images. Inspect the image dimensions and resolution settings before initiating the printing process.
Tip 2: Select Paper Type Appropriate for Coloring Medium. Thicker paper stock, such as cardstock, prevents bleed-through when using markers or watercolor pencils, yielding superior results compared to standard printer paper.
Tip 3: Review Copyright and Usage Restrictions. Adherence to licensing terms is critical. Ensure that the intended usepersonal, educational, or commercialis permitted by the copyright holder. Locate and review the associated licensing information before using content.
Tip 4: Optimize Printer Settings for Line Art. Adjust printer settings to enhance the clarity and sharpness of lines. Select “black and white” or “grayscale” printing to minimize ink consumption. Consider increasing the contrast setting for sharper lines.
Tip 5: Offer a Diverse Range of Designs to Accommodate Varied Skill Levels. Provide a selection that includes simple, large-format designs for younger children or beginners, as well as more intricate and detailed designs for older children and adults.
Tip 6: Utilize Digital Editing Software for Customization. Prior to printing, digital editing software can be used to resize, crop, or add personalized elements to the images. This allows for the creation of unique and customized coloring pages.
Tip 7: Safeguard Digital Devices from Potential Malware. Before downloading resources from the Internet, ensure the computer or device has updated antivirus software. Scan downloaded files for potential threats.
